Why Upgrade Door Handles?

Updating door handles can seem unimportant when considering bigger renovations fresh floor covering or fresh paint. However, door handles act as both functional hardware and decorative accents. Here are some engaging reasons to consider an upgrade:

  1. Aesthetic Enhancement: New handles can quickly enhance the look of a room, matching your existing design and elevating your home's overall style.
  2. Improved Functionality: Often, older handles may end up being sticky or hard to open. Upgrading to new handles can enhance usability, specifically for kids and the elderly.
  3. Increased Security: Modern door handles frequently consist of better locking mechanisms and products that can discourage undesirable access.
  4. Boosted Property Value: A well-kept and stylishly designated home can lead to higher resale worths. Upgrading components such as door handles can contribute to this appeal.
  5. Modification Opportunities: With numerous designs and finishes readily available, homeowners can personalize door handles to fit their personal tastes and home style themes.

Various Styles of Door Handles

When it pertains to door handle styles, the options can be overwhelming. Here are some popular alternatives categorized for clearness:

1. Conventional

  • Lever Handles: Best for a classic look, they are easy to operate and often made from brass or bronze.
  • Knobs: Available in different materials and blends well with vintage or cottage-style homes.

2. Contemporary

  • Minimalist Levers: Sleek and basic, these handles typically feature geometric shapes and finish choices like stainless-steel or matte black.
  • Magnetic or Touch Less Handles: Technology-driven choices that improve convenience and are great for modern areas.

3. Rustic

  • Reclaimed Wood Handles: Ideal for a cabin or farmhouse appearance, these give a warm, welcoming touch.
  • Antique-Finished Metal: Adds character and beauty, typically fitting well into a rustic or industrial design.

4. Smart Handles

  • Keyless Entry Systems: These high-tech handles couple with clever home systems, allowing for lock control via mobile phones.
  • Biometric Locks: Providing included security through fingerprint acknowledgment, suitable for high-security applications.

Aspects to Consider

When choosing for a door handle upgrade, several aspects ought to be kept in mind to guarantee the best choice for your area:

  • Compatibility: Consider the existing door thickness and the type of latch or lock already in place. Many handles are designed for standard measurements, but variations do exist.
  • Material Quality: Assess the toughness and visual appeal of the materials. Strong metals typically supply greater durability compared to plastic.
  • Ergonomics: Choose handles that fit conveniently in hand, specifically for those with mobility issues.
  • End up Type: The surface needs to line up not just with the desired aesthetic however also with the functionality. For example, satin surfaces withstand finger prints, while polished surfaces may need more maintenance.
  • Design Cohesion: Ensure that chosen handles enhance the more comprehensive style of your home, incorporating perfectly with other style components.

DIY Installation Steps

For the enthusiastic house owner, upgrading door handles can be a manageable DIY project. Here's a detailed guide:

Preparation

  1. Collect Tools: You will need a screwdriver (flat and Phillips), measuring tape, a pencil, and perhaps a drill for brand-new hole positionings.
  2. Choose Your Handles: Ensure they fit your wanted style and compatibility with existing doors.

Installation Process

Get Rid Of Old Handles:

  • Unscrew the existing handles from the door.
  • Thoroughly pull the handle and get rid of the lock mechanism if changing.

Step for New Handles:

  • Measure the existing holes to guarantee brand-new handles align.
  • If drilling brand-new holes, determine the distance from the edge of the door to the center of the handle.

Set up the Latch:

  • Insert the brand-new latch mechanism into the edge of the door and secure it with screws.

Connect the Handles:

  • Align the handles with the lock, guaranteeing they fit comfortably.
  • Protect the handles with the offered screws.

Test Functionality:

  • Open and close the door numerous times to ensure smooth operation.

Final Touches

  • Tidy the area around the handle and appreciate your brand-new upgrade!

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How typically should I consider updating door handles?

While there's no stringent timeline, it's a great idea to reassess door handles every 5 to 10 years. If you notice indications of wear, malfunction, or if you're upgrading the total decor of your home, it may be time for an upgrade.

2. Are there any particular brand names known for premium door handles?

3. Can I mix different door handle styles in my home?

While it's usually best to keep style cohesion, incorporating different handle styles can include character if done attentively. For circumstances, maintaining a color plan or material consistency can help combine the look.

4. What if I have problem installing the handles myself?

If DIY jobs feel daunting, think about working with a regional handyman or contractor to guarantee professional installation. This can save time and avoid prospective damage.
